What is the difference between Public Administration vs Public Policy?
| Aspect | Public Administration | Public Policy |
|---|---|---|
| Required Credentials | Bachelor's or Master's in Public Administration, Public Policy, or related fields | Bachelor's or Master's in Public Policy, Political Science, or related fields |
| Work Environment | Government agencies, non-profits, public sector organizations | Think tanks, government offices, research institutions |
| Employer & Industry Usage | Public sector organizations managing operations and services | Policy analysis, development, and advocacy roles |
| Common Search & Comparison | Public Administration vs Public Policy |
Public Administration focuses on managing public sector organizations and implementing policies, while Public Policy emphasizes analyzing, developing, and advocating for policies. Both roles often require similar educational backgrounds and work in government or non-profit sectors, but their core functions differ: administration manages operations, whereas policy focuses on creating and influencing policies.

REQUIRED QUALIFICATIONS
Candidates should have prior teaching experience at the university level. Candidates should demonstrate their ability to interact and work effectively with a wide and culturally diverse range of students, including first-generation college students.
In order to be considered for a teaching assignment in PAJ, temporary faculty must be either:
Academically qualified: A temporary faculty member is academically qualified by virtue of holding a Ph.D. (or achieving ABD status with an expected graduation date), D.P.A., J.D. or MA/MS/MPA in a field related to his or her teaching responsibilities and maintaining scholarship activities to support his/her teaching.
Professionally qualified: A temporary faculty member can be professionally qualified by virtue of having a record of outstanding professional experience directly relevant to his/her teaching assignment. A professionally qualified faculty member will have a graduate degree as well as professional experience in a field related to his or her teaching responsibilities. Additionally, professionally qualified faculty will engage in professional and/or community service in an area that supports his or her teaching responsibilities.
The minimum level of education required to teach at the 100-300 level is a master's degree or ABD (even without a master's degree) in a relevant field. In order to teach a course at the 400-level and graduate level, temporary faculty must have a terminal degree in their field (Ph.D., D.P.A., and J.D. are considered terminal degrees for courses taught in PAJ). In cases of exigent curricular circumstances, departure from these requirements may be made at the discretion of the division chair in consultation with the department coordinator(s).

APPOINTMENT AND SALARY
All part-time faculty appointments are made as Lecturers, under the terms of the Collective Bargaining Agreement between the CSU system and the California Faculty Association. Initial appointments are for one semester only.
Classification Range: $5,507 - $6,677 per month
Anticipated hiring range depending on qualifications, not to exceed $6,221 per month
The full-time (15 units per semester) monthly base salaries indicated above are prorated to the number of units worked and are paid in six monthly payments for each full semester. For a three-unit assignment, typical starting compensation ranges from $6,608.40 to $7,465.20 per semester.
